Andrew Mills is the co-founder of Jumpline, a community hub driving the transformation of journalism education. He is also an associate at FATHM, a UK-based news-lab and consultancy. Previously, he helped establish the Medill journalism program at Northwestern University’s international campus in Qatar and led the design of a new, overhauled curriculum for the campus. As an educator, his teaching has focused on media innovation, international reporting and the use of emerging technology to gather news and tell stories. He has reported from more than 25 countries and helps design and lead collaborative journalism projects around the world.
